diff options
| author | Oleg Nesterov <oleg@redhat.com> | 2014-06-06 14:36:51 -0700 |
|---|---|---|
| committer | Moyster <oysterized@gmail.com> | 2019-05-02 18:16:05 +0200 |
| commit | 5180379c2735f48ec8fcfb6af4ce95fe6b8406bb (patch) | |
| tree | 3751609b86ad4d04a36fafd866dfc18eb9c55def /tools/scripts | |
| parent | bced2cc2a416a8b786119df85f4f346518998b82 (diff) | |
signals: cleanup the usage of t/current in do_sigaction()
The usage of "task_struct *t" and "current" in do_sigaction() looks really
annoying and chaotic. Initially "t" is used as a cached value of current
but not consistently, then it is reused as a loop variable and we have to
use "current" again.
Clean up this mess and also convert the code to use for_each_thread().
Change-Id: Ibafe371d596e164661767b21d5550a1e0bd740ff
Signed-off-by: Oleg Nesterov <oleg@redhat.com>
Cc: Peter Zijlstra <peterz@infradead.org>
Cc: Al Viro <viro@ZenIV.linux.org.uk>
Cc: David Woodhouse <dwmw2@infradead.org>
Cc: Frederic Weisbecker <fweisbec@gmail.com>
Cc: Geert Uytterhoeven <geert@linux-m68k.org>
Cc: Ingo Molnar <mingo@kernel.org>
Cc: Mathieu Desnoyers <mathieu.desnoyers@efficios.com>
Cc: Richard Weinberger <richard@nod.at>
Cc: Steven Rostedt <rostedt@goodmis.org>
Cc: Tejun Heo <tj@kernel.org>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
Diffstat (limited to 'tools/scripts')
0 files changed, 0 insertions, 0 deletions
